Hearty Majorcan baked rice with pork, sobrasada and seasonal vegetables. A traditional Sunday family dish across the island.
Crisp spiral pastry dusted with sugar, traditionally eaten for breakfast or fiestas in Mallorca. Best with hot chocolate or coffee.
Cured Majorcan sausage made with pork, paprika and spices. It is one of the island’s signature foods and widely used in local cooking.

Tipping is optional. In restaurants, round up or leave 5-10% for good service; cafés often just round up; taxis usually round up to the nearest euro.
